Santiago Hernandez

Adjunct Faculty

Santiago Hernandez teaches Advanced Projects in Painting, Abstract Painting, Collage, Mixed Media Assemblage, Abstract Drawing, and Interdisciplinary Studio courses here at the College of Art and Design. In addition to his teaching and professional work as a painter, Santiago is a professional musician. He plays jazz drums and Afro-Cuban percussion. He performs regularly in the Boston area with various ensembles and his own jazz trio.
